    Re: BEKO Washing Machine WM6355W 1500rpm Drum Bang and knock

    Just like car shocks, push down on drum and they should’nt bounce. The speed of the motor is controlled by the tachometer generator on the end of the motor. It’s like a dynamo, generates a small electrical current that is measured by the control module. If the motor suddenly breaks into a fast rotation then the problem is associated with that tachometer circuit.

    From your description I would think the problem is not the shocks though they are cheap to replace anyway,

    Re: Miele washing machine. Drum hits door seal

    Yes sorry, spider or drum spigot. The 3 legged drum support in essence. One of the arms may have corroded and broken.

    Best way to know is if the drum doesn’t rotate evenly as it should but has an elliptical rotation and catches the door boot in one spot. That’s a dead giveaway. 😉
